Sigil City of Doors is finally releasing its big update next weekend, with among other things these features:
- New playable races (selectable from character creation screen).
- Scry tool that will show where players are on server currently (doesn't show specific player location, only general numbers, and you can always opt out to become invisible for the scry tool)
- New faction areas.
- New hunting areas.
- Tweakings on monsters and areas.
- New monster models
- New clothing appearances.
- Summons have been reworked. (see bottom of this post for more details)

Monster Summoning Changes: wrote:
Summon Monster
Good
1 Small Viper
2 Celestial Bombardier Beetle
3 Celestial Bear
4 Lantern Archon
5 Hound Archon
6 Bralani Eladrin
7 Djinni
8 Celestial Dire Bear
9 Guardian Naga
Evil
1 Fiendish Rat
2 Fiendish Wolf
3 Hell Hound
4 Fiendish Dire Wolf
5 Shadow Mastiff
6 Bezekira (hell cat)
7 Bulezau
8 Gargantuan Fiendish Spider
9 Hezrou
Neutral
1 Gibberling
2 Hook Spider
3 Xorn, Minor
4 Carrion Crawler
5 Displacer Beast
6 Gelatinous Cube
7 Xorn
8 Blue Slaad
9 Green Slaad
Spirit Shaman
1 Spirit Warrior
2 Spirit Crossbower
3 Spirit Fighter
4 Spirit Fencer
5 Spirit Lurker
6 Spirit Berserker
7 Spirit Archer
8 Spirit Sneaker
9 Spirit Magician
Druid
1 Small Viper
2 Hook Spider
3 Stirge
4 Smilodon
5 Displacer Beast
6 Megaraptor
7 Xorn
8 Noble Salamander
9 Unicorn
Blackguard Fiend - Succubus/Erinyes
Hellfire Warlock - Neeshka replaced with Bulezau, otherwise no changes
Planar Binding, lesser
Chaotic/Neutral - Red Slaad
Evil - Imp
Good - Moon Dog
Lawful - Duodrone
Planar Binding/Planar Ally
Chaotic - Succubus
Good - Celestial Bear
Lawful - Erinyes
Neutral - Sylph
Greater Planar Binding
Chaotic - Succubus
Good - Celestial Dire Bear
Lawful - Erinyes
Neutral - Elemental
Gate
Chaotic - Death Slaad
Evil - Horned Devil
Good - Astral Deva
Lawful - Marut Inevitable
Epic Gate
Evil - Balor
Good - Planetar
Improved but otherwise unchanged:
Animate Dead (HD now increase with caster level)
Create Undead (the Wraith improved somewhat)
Fiendish Heritage (should also now have a duration longer than 1 round)
Shadow Conjuration
Greater Shadow Conjuration
Pale Master Summons
Death Domain
Dead Walk (HD now increase with caster level)
Shadow Dancer Summon
Extract Water Elemental (duration increase only)
